Source view does not exist in database

When I select a task map I get error message "Source View vw_ViewName used in the mapping does not exist in the database".  Then the edit mapping window opens and the Landing Zone Columns section and the View dropdown options are empty.

The view exists in the source database and the user account has access to it.

You probably need to clear the metadata cache and/or the landing cache.

Thanks, went into Manage under DW and the "Clear Landing Cache" did the trick.

The only other suggestion I can think of would be to change the project settings to check "Generate DDL scripts but do not run them", then generate instructions for the task that uses the source view, and then go back to the project settings, uncheck the same box, and then generate the instructions again. Sometimes that gets the metadata in sync when clearing the cache doesn't work.
